Understanding Free Cash Flow
Free cash flow (FCF) is the cash remaining after a company pays operating expenses and capital expenditures. Positive FCF means the company generates real cash that can be used for dividends, share buybacks, acquisitions, or debt reduction. Many investors consider FCF more reliable than net income because it is harder to manipulate.
